Output 21f8e295de14f051b9aa33b88156a1b13dcb88b3495efda7de01d3c151a37873:1

value
5007921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fbae926d1fd769d64362d1c7c4e040c380b8650 OP_EQUAL
address
34annH22QjibtkrBox56gXdNYzjwZfEWVn
transaction
21f8e295de14f051b9aa33b88156a1b13dcb88b3495efda7de01d3c151a37873
spent
true